Q3 Planning Note — Annual Billing Transition

Sales leads: beginning next quarter, Brightloom Systems will steer all new Corvette-tier deals toward annual billing. Monthly plans remain available but should be positioned as a premium option with a 12% uplift. Renewal conversations for existing accounts should probe willingness to prepay before we formalize incentives. Marit Olsen will circulate updated quote templates by the 14th. The rationale behind this push is outlined in the note below.

management briefing: Jorixax Holdings is in early talks to buy Casixax Holdings for about $420.3 million. The Fenmir launch date is October 27, and nothing goes to the press before then. Legal wants the Keloxek Foods term sheet redrafted before April 16.

**Handover: Gauger sidecar**

Taking over from me: Gauger aggregates metrics per-pod and flushes to the Ombric store every 15s. Known quirks: flush stalls if the buffer crosses 80% — restart fixes it, root cause unfound. Don't raise cardinality limits without checking memory headroom first. The staging deploy lags prod by one version on purpose; keep it that way until the histogram fix lands. Alerts route to the platform channel. All tuning lives in one place — current values follow below.

config for kagup-hahig:
druwyn:
  pin: 2801
  metrics_host: metrics.druwyn.zemvarlabs.internal
  tenant: sorius
  seal: seal_798a43d7

## Authentication

Plugins for Widediff must authenticate against the Fenwick render service before requesting chunked diffs of files over 200 MB. Pass the key in the request header on every call; sessions are not cached. Rate limits apply per plugin, not per user. Use the following key for the staging endpoint:

API key for yahig-tadup: kto7_ubizbYm

Handover — calibration weights, batch 14

Taking over from Dorla while she's on leave. The batch of calibration weights from the Quenby lab has been checked against the reference list and re-boxed in the padded grey cases. Two weights showed minor corrosion and are flagged in the log. The whole set goes back to Quenby via courier on Friday morning. When the courier arrives, apply the following confidential instruction:

handover note for yagef-bagep: the drudor pelius courier leaves the kasdor zorvan norir ledger at gate 8016 under passcode 755406